Dia
Mirza
and
her
hubby
Vaibhav
Rekhi
became
proud
parents
of
a
baby
boy
Avyaan
earlier
this
year.
The
newborn
was
born
via
an
emergency
C-section
in
May.
However,
Dia
and
Vaibhav
introduced
him
to
the
world
in
July.
Since
then
the
Rehnaa
Hai
Tere
Dil
Mein
actress
has
been
sharing
glimpses
of
her
tiny
tot.
Today,
the
new
mommy
in
town
took
to
her
Instagram
handle
to
share
a
heartwarming
picture
with
Avyaan
in
which
his
face
is
visible
for
the
first
time.
The
black
and
white
portrait
features
Dia
putting
her
son
to
sleep
and
it's
such
a
blissful
moment.
She
captioned
it
as,
"Our
story
has
only
just
begun
Avyaan
🐯🧿
15.09.2021."
Meanwhile
netizens
showered
the
little
bundle
of
joy
with
lots
of
love.
